Job Description
Location: Remote / Hybrid
Experience Level: Mid (3–4 years)
Industry: Digital / Web / Financial Services
Job Overview:
We are seeking a talented Front End / Web Engineer to own the full lifecycle of web development, from design and implementation to testing and optimization. You will collaborate with cross-functional teams—including product, design, and backend engineers—to build performant, user-centric websites that deliver exceptional experiences. This role emphasizes modern frontend frameworks, accessibility, performance, and adherence to web development best practices.
Key Responsibilities:
- Take ownership of end-to-end web development, including design, coding, unit testing, and implementation.
- Collaborate with QA teams to ensure proper testing, maintenance, and continuous improvement.
- Work closely with product and design teams to build efficient, user-centric web interfaces.
- Champion web development best practices, performance optimization, and coding standards.
- Integrate frontend components with backend APIs to ensure smooth data flow.
- Ensure cross-browser and cross-device compatibility.
- Maintain accessibility standards (WCAG 2.1) to ensure usability for people with impairments.
- Implement security principles relevant to web development.
- Work with web analytics and marketing tools such as Google Analytics and Google Tag Manager.
- Participate in Agile development processes, sprint planning, and code reviews.
- Contribute to CI/CD processes and utilize container technologies like Docker and Kubernetes where applicable.
Required Skills & Qualifications:
- 3–4 years of experience in web development, including at least 2–3 years of hands-on frontend development.
- Strong proficiency in JavaScript, including DOM manipulation, object-oriented concepts, and design patterns.
- Advanced knowledge of HTML5, CSS3, and responsive design principles.
- Experience with frontend frameworks/libraries like React or Next.js.
- Familiarity with TypeScript is a plus.
- Knowledge of version control systems (preferably Azure DevOps).
- Experience with Agile development methodologies.
- Strong problem-solving, communication, and collaboration skills.
Preferred / Bonus Qualifications:
- Experience in the financial services industry.
- Familiarity with CI/CD pipelines, Docker, and Kubernetes.
- Knowledge of web performance optimization techniques and security best practices.
- Experience implementing analytics and tag management integrations.
Why Join Us:
- Opportunity to own full web projects from start to finish.
- Work in a collaborative, cross-functional environment.
- Build scalable, accessible, and high-performing web solutions.
- Exposure to modern web technologies and containerized deployment environments.